Description
Veterinary Hematology and Clinical Chemistry, 2nd Edition, (PDF) serves as a comprehensive and richly illustrated resource, expertly designed for veterinary professionals seeking knowledge in laboratory diagnostic practices and interpretation. This essential reference delves into the fields of hematology and clinical chemistry, encompassing a diverse array of species including reptiles, amphibians, avians, and aquatic life. The ebook presents a holistic overview of vital veterinary competencies necessary for accurate diagnostics and treatment planning.
The Second Edition has undergone significant enhancements, with numerous revisions and the introduction of new chapters dedicated to advanced topics such as molecular diagnostics pertaining to hematologic malignancies and lipid pathology. It reflects the latest advancements in diagnostic technologies, presenting updated information on instrumentation and methodologies that will empower practitioners and enhance their diagnostic acumen. Additionally, substantial revisions have been made to the data interpretation chapter, offering introductory guidance that is current and applicable. Readers can also find the latest insights into immunodiagnostics and laboratory assessments of endocrine, renal, and calcium metabolic disorders.
Beginning with foundational concepts of laboratory testing, this ebook transitions into an extensive exploration of hematologic and biochemical profiles in both domestic and non-domestic animal species. Enhanced clinical case presentations have been thoughtfully integrated throughout, providing rich case data alongside narrative discussions aimed at cultivating critical thinking and practical application skills. Ideal for veterinary students, pathologists, technicians, and researchers, Veterinary Hematology and Clinical Chemistry 2e stands as a vital resource that no veterinary library should be without.
